Job Description :
Assemble new tools and subassemblies as needed to fill customer orders, and repair tools sent in by customers for repair, by performing the duties described below. Duties and Responsibilities :
Assemble all tools and subassemblies as needed for customer orders. Verify that tools are operating to specifications as set out by engineering, and have all accessories and safety features required by company for that individual tool. Able to use tachometers and dynamometers as appropriate to insure tools are operating to specifications.
Report any shortages or potential shortages of parts in the approved manner.
Repair any tools that come in for repair. Insure that repaired tools are clean, operating correctly, and meet all safety requirements before sending back to the customer.
Communicate to engineering any quality or design issues that arise based on wear or breakage of repair tools.
Repair returned tools to new condition, or strip them for any usable parts or subassemblies.
Communicate quotes, maintenance issues, and safety concerns with customers when performing repairs. File needed paperwork for repairs so billing and record keeping can be maintained.
Use calipers, micrometers and other inspection equipment. Read and understand schematic and dimensional drawings. Inspect new and repair parts to insure that they meet specifications as set by engineering. Inspect parts that do not work correctly, compare them to current parts prints, and be able to Advise engineering or manufacturing as to specific problems with parts.
Return unused parts, tools and assemblies to inventory correctly, neatly and accurately.
Identify all parts in inventory. Put parts away into inventory as needed.
Restock parts bins from overstock as needed.
Strive to improve assembly times and quality for subassemblies and tools.
Assist others in assembly or repair as needed.
Deburr parts as necessary.
Keep work area, part storage, and surrounding areas clean and safe.
Assist with shipping and receiving, loading, unloading and deliveries as needed.
Support positive work environment. Requirements
To perform this job successfully, the individual must be able to define problems, collect data and draw valid conclusions. The individual must have the ability to understand and interpret an extensive variety of technical instructions in mathematical or diagram form and deal with program problems. The individual must be able to communicate effectively with others.
You must be able to lift 70 lbs.
Education and Experience High school diploma, general education degree (GED), or 3 years related experience and / or training, or an equivalent combination of education and experience.
